Caring about improving vocabulary and grammar for 6-year-olds is crucial since it builds the foundation for their future communication skills and academic success. At this age, children's ability to understand and use language is rapidly expanding, and early intervention can significantly influence their cognitive and social development.
Vocabulary enrichment enables children to express themselves clearly and comprehend others better, enhancing their ability to engage in meaningful conversations and social interactions. A robust vocabulary also assists in reading comprehension, which is fundamental for learning across all subjects. It makes new concepts more accessible, fueling curiosity and a love for learning.
Grammar, on the other hand, structures communication coherently. Mastering basic grammatical rules helps children construct sentences correctly, making their speech intelligible. Proper grammar also fosters essential critical thinking skills, as children begin to understand the logical structure of language.
Furthermore, strong vocabulary and grammar skills are directly linked to academic achievement. Proficiency in these areas allows children to follow instructions accurately, understand texts, and articulate their ideas during time at school. This ease in communication builds confidence, fosters learning motivation, and reduces frustration.
Investing in vocabulary and grammar at an early age lays the groundwork for children to not only succeed academically but also to thrive socially and emotionally.
